Unable to install InstallShield Scripting Runtime” when trying to install the program? (KB029009) Modified on: Tue, Jul 15, 2014 at 9:02 AM This issue occurs on some systems depending on the system configuration. Please try the following instructions in order to help solve this issue: Note: When performing any installation, please make sure that you have Administrative privileges for the computer. If you are unfamiliar with this, you may need to consult the documentation that comes with your computer, or contact your System Administrator SOLUTION 1:Restart your computer. Sometimes, an installation is running at the same time, or one of the files or services on the computer is in use. Once the computer has restarted, re-insert the first CD and start the installation over again. SOLUTION 2:Install the InstallShield InstallScript engine. To do this, you will need to click on the following link to download the IsScript.zip file: http://support.installshield.com/kb/files/Q107094/IsScript.zip When prompted to Run or Save the file, select the Save option and select a location to save it, such as your desktop. After the file has completed the download, double-click on the file to open it. Extract the IsScript.msi file to a location, such as your desktop. Once that is extracted, double-click on that file to run the IsScript installation. After this installation has been performed, reboot your computer and try to install the software again. SOLUTION 3: Try to register the Windows Installer service on the computer. To do this, click on the Start button and select the Run option. In the Open field on the Run window, type the command that is appropriate for your version of Windows: Windows XP: C:\Windows\System32\Msiexec.exe /REGSERVER Windows 2000:C:\Winnt\System32\Msiexec.exe /REGSERVER Windows 98 or Me: C:\Windows\System\Msiexec.exe /REGSERVER After you have done this, reboot the computer and start the installation over again.
